The KS W ISO 7137-2018 (2023) standard, published by the Korea Agency for Technology and Standards (KATS), is an essential document in the field of aviation technology. This standard provides detailed guidelines on environmental conditions and testing procedures for airborne equipment installed within aircraft. It ensures that all electronic devices, systems, and components are designed and tested under rigorous conditions to meet safety and performance standards.
The scope of this standard includes specifying the environmental parameters such as temperature, humidity, pressure, and radiation levels which are crucial for determining the operational limits of onboard equipment. Additionally, it outlines specific testing procedures that must be followed during the development phase to ensure compliance with these conditions.
By adhering to KS W ISO 7137-2018 (2023), manufacturers can guarantee that their products will operate reliably in various flight scenarios and environmental challenges. This standard is an adaptation of the International Organization for Standardization's ISO 7137, specifically tailored to meet the unique requirements of the Korean aviation industry.
The document serves as a critical reference for engineers, designers, testers, and quality assurance professionals working on airborne equipment projects. It aids in minimizing operational risks associated with environmental stress factors and contributes significantly towards enhancing overall aircraft safety.
